preguntar acerca de postgresql-performance

6
réponses

Exécuter PostgreSQL en mémoire uniquement

je veux lancer une petite base de données PostgreSQL qui fonctionne en mémoire uniquement, pour chaque test unitaire que j'écris. Par exemple: @Before void setUp() { String port = runPostgresOnRandomPort(); connectTo("postgres://localh …
demandé sur 1970-01-01 00:33:31
3
réponses

Y a-t-il des inconvénients à utiliser le type de données «text» pour stocker des chaînes de caractères?

selon documentation Postgres , ils supportent 3 types de données pour les données de caractères: character varying(n), varchar(n) variable-length with limit character(n), char(n) fixed-length, blank padded text …
demandé sur 1970-01-01 00:33:33
3
réponses

Optimiser le groupe par requête pour récupérer le dernier enregistrement par utilisateur

j'ai le tableau suivant (procédure simplifiée) dans Postgresql 9.2 CREATE TABLE user_msg_log ( aggr_date DATE, user_id INTEGER, running_total INTEGER ); Il contient un enregistrement par utilisateur et par jour. Il y aura e …
demandé sur 1970-01-01 00:33:34
4
réponses

Optimisation de la requête postgrès (forçage d’un scan index)

voici ma requête. J'essaie de l'amener à utiliser un scan index, mais il ne fera que seq scan. soit dit en passant, la table metric_data contient 130 millions de lignes. Le tableau metrics comporte environ 2000 lignes. metric_data …
demandé sur 1970-01-01 00:33:33